The Rise of Smart Contracts and AI in Legal Systems

The rapid growth of digital technology has transformed nearly every sector of society, including commerce, healthcare, education, governance, and communication. Among all these sectors, the legal field is now experiencing one of the most significant technological shifts in modern history. Artificial Intelligence and smart contracts are increasingly becoming part of legal systems, changing the manner in which laws are interpreted, contracts are enforced, disputes are resolved, and legal services are delivered. The traditional legal framework, which has long depended upon human interpretation and manual procedures, is gradually integrating technological tools to improve efficiency, accuracy, and accessibility. The rise of Artificial Intelligence in legal systems reflects a    broader movement toward automation and data-driven decision-making. AI systems are capable of analyzing large amounts of legal information within a short period of time. They can review documents, identify legal risks, predict possible outcomes of disputes, and assist lawyers in legal research. Courts and legal institutions around the world are also exploring the use of AI to improve judicial administration and case management. At the same time, blockchain technology has introduced the concept of smart contracts, which are digital agreements capable of executing themselves automatically once specific conditions are fulfilled. These developments represent a major evolution in legal practice and governance. Supporters argue that AI and smart contracts can reduce delays, lower legal costs, improve consistency, and increase access to justice. In many countries, overloaded court systems and complex administrative procedures create barriers for individuals seeking legal remedies. Technology is therefore seen as a solution that can modernize outdated systems and simplify legal processes. However, the integration of technology into legal systems also raises serious legal, ethical, and constitutional concerns. The law is not merely a mechanical process based on rules and calculations. It is deeply connected to principles of justice, fairness, equity, morality, and human rights. Legal reasoning often requires interpretation, emotional understanding, and discretion that cannot easily be replicated through algorithms or coded instructions. Questions therefore arise regarding whether AI systems and automated contracts can truly function within a system that is fundamentally human-centered. The growing influence of technology also creates concerns regarding accountability, transparency, bias, cybersecurity, privacy, and judicial independence. If an AI system produces a discriminatory outcome or if a smart contract executes incorrectly, determining responsibility becomes legally complex. Similarly, automated systems may lack the flexibility needed to handle exceptional circumstances that frequently arise in legal disputes. The rise of smart contracts and AI in legal systems is therefore both an opportunity and a challenge. It offers the possibility of transforming legal institutions into faster and more efficient systems, while also requiring careful regulation to ensure that technological advancement does not undermine the rule of law. The future of legal systems will depend on how effectively society balances innovation with the preservation of justice and human rights.

Meaning and Nature of Smart Contracts

Smart contracts are one of the most important technological developments associated with blockchain technology. A smart contract is a self-executing digital agreement in which the terms and conditions are written in computer code. These contracts operate automatically when predetermined conditions are satisfied. Unlike traditional agreements that often require intermediaries such as lawyers, brokers, or banks to supervise performance, smart contracts function independently through decentralized blockchain networks. The concept of smart contracts was introduced to create agreements that are efficient, secure, transparent, and resistant to manipulation. Blockchain technology ensures that once information is recorded, it becomes extremely difficult to alter or tamper with it. This creates a reliable and permanent record of contractual transactions. The decentralized nature of blockchain further reduces dependence on centralized authorities, making transactions faster and more transparent. Smart contracts are commonly used in financial transactions, cryptocurrency exchanges, insurance systems, digital asset management, supply chain operations, and online services. For example, in a commercial transaction, a smart contract may automatically transfer payment once goods are delivered and verified. Similarly, in insurance claims, compensation may be released automatically once specific conditions are confirmed through digital verification systems. The operation of smart contracts depends entirely on coded instructions. Once activated, they execute automatically without requiring additional approval from the contracting parties. This reduces delays and minimizes the possibility of non-performance. The automation process also reduces human intervention, which may lower the risk of administrative errors or intentional misconduct. Despite these advantages, smart contracts differ significantly from traditional legal agreements. Traditional contracts are generally drafted in natural language and interpreted according to legal principles, judicial precedents, and the intention of the parties. Smart contracts, however, rely on programming language and automated execution. This creates important legal questions regarding interpretation, enforceability, and dispute resolution. One major concern is that smart contracts may lack flexibility. Traditional contracts often allow room for negotiation, interpretation, and adjustment based on changing circumstances. Smart contracts, by contrast, execute strictly according to predefined instructions. If coding errors exist or unforeseen circumstances arise, the system may still execute the contract in a manner that produces unfair or unintended results. The legal status of smart contracts also varies across jurisdictions. Some countries have begun recognizing electronic contracts and blockchain transactions within their legal frameworks, while others are still developing regulations. Courts may face difficulties in interpreting coded agreements and determining whether they satisfy the essential elements of a legally enforceable contract, including consent, lawful consideration, capacity, and intention to create legal relations. As blockchain technology continues to evolve, smart contracts are expected to become increasingly significant in both domestic and international transactions. However, their integration into legal systems requires careful legal regulation to ensure that automation does not compromise fairness, accountability, or contractual justice.

Artificial Intelligence and Its Growing Role in Legal Systems

Artificial Intelligence refers to computer systems capable of performing tasks that normally require human intelligence. These tasks include learning, reasoning, analysis, prediction, language processing, and decision-making. In legal systems, AI is becoming an increasingly valuable tool for lawyers, judges, corporations, governments, and legal researchers. The legal profession traditionally involves large amounts of documentation, research, analysis, and interpretation. AI technologies are particularly useful in handling repetitive and data-intensive tasks. AI-powered software can analyze thousands of legal documents within minutes, identify relevant case laws, detect patterns, and provide recommendations based on existing legal data. One of the most important applications of AI in law is legal research. Lawyers often spend considerable time reviewing statutes, judicial decisions, regulations, and legal commentaries. AI systems can simplify this process by quickly identifying relevant precedents and legal authorities. This improves efficiency and allows legal professionals to devote more attention to strategic analysis and client representation. AI is also widely used in contract analysis and compliance management. Organizations frequently manage large numbers of contracts involving different legal obligations and deadlines. AI tools can examine these contracts, identify important clauses, detect inconsistencies, and highlight legal risks. This reduces manual workload and increases accuracy in contract management. Another growing area of AI application is predictive legal analysis. Certain AI systems are designed to evaluate patterns in judicial decisions and estimate the likelihood of specific outcomes in legal disputes. Such systems may assist lawyers in developing litigation strategies and advising clients regarding possible legal risks. Courts and judicial institutions are also experimenting with AI technologies for administrative purposes. AI may assist in scheduling cases, organizing court records, managing procedural documents, and reducing administrative delays. In some jurisdictions, AI systems are used to support bail decisions, sentencing recommendations, or dispute classification. However, these practices remain controversial due to concerns regarding fairness and accountability.AI additionally contributes to improving access to legal services. Many individuals are unable to afford professional legal representation due to high costs and procedural complexity. AI-powered legal assistance platforms can provide basic legal guidance, generate standard legal documents, and answer common legal questions. This may help bridge the gap between legal systems and economically disadvantaged individuals. Despite these benefits, AI systems are not capable of replacing the complete role of legal professionals. Legal reasoning involves interpretation, ethical judgment, social understanding, and emotional sensitivity. Human lawyers and judges consider not only written rules but also the broader context of disputes and the impact of decisions on individuals and society. AI systems operate primarily through data patterns and algorithms, which may not fully capture the complexities of justice. The increasing use of AI therefore requires a balanced approach. Technology can support legal professionals and improve efficiency, but it should not replace the human judgment that remains essential to the administration of justice.

Relationship Between Blockchain Technology and Legal Innovation

Blockchain technology serves as the foundation for smart contracts and plays a major role in legal innovation. Blockchain is a decentralized digital ledger that records transactions across multiple systems securely and transparently. Every transaction recorded on the blockchain is verified through consensus mechanisms and stored permanently, making it highly resistant to fraud and unauthorized modification. The legal significance of blockchain lies in its ability to create reliable records without depending on centralized authorities. Traditional legal systems often rely on intermediaries such as banks, registrars, and government institutions to verify transactions and maintain records. Blockchain technology reduces dependence on such intermediaries by allowing direct peer-to-peer verification. In legal systems, blockchain can improve record management, evidence preservation, intellectual property protection, and contract enforcement. Legal documents stored on blockchain networks may be more secure and easier to verify. This can reduce document tampering, forgery, and disputes relating to authenticity. Blockchain technology may also transform property transactions. Land records and ownership information stored on blockchain systems could increase transparency and reduce corruption in property registration processes. Similarly, intellectual property rights such as copyrights and trademarks may be protected through blockchain-based verification systems. The use of blockchain in legal systems also raises regulatory concerns. Since blockchain networks often operate across national borders, determining jurisdiction and applicable law becomes difficult. Regulatory authorities must therefore develop legal frameworks capable of addressing international digital transactions and decentralized systems.

Integration of AI and Smart Contracts in Modern Legal Systems

The combination of AI and smart contracts represents a new stage in the evolution of legal technology. Smart contracts provide automated execution, while AI adds analytical and adaptive capabilities. Together, these technologies may create highly advanced systems capable of managing legal processes with minimal human intervention. AI can improve the functioning of smart contracts by interpreting data, monitoring compliance, detecting irregularities, and making predictive assessments. For example, AI systems may analyze market conditions, delivery records, or financial information before allowing a smart contract to execute a transaction. This integration creates more flexible and intelligent systems capable of responding to real-world conditions. In the financial sector, AI and smart contracts are being used for automated lending, investment management, fraud detection, and digital asset transactions. In insurance, claims may be processed automatically based on verified data and AI analysis. In healthcare, smart contracts may regulate secure access to patient records while AI systems assist in compliance monitoring and medical analysis. International trade may also benefit from these technologies. Commercial agreements involving multiple parties and jurisdictions often involve delays and administrative complexity. Smart contracts can automate payment processes and logistics management, while AI can analyze trade risks and monitor regulatory compliance. Despite these opportunities, the integration of AI and smart contracts creates significant legal challenges. Automated systems may struggle to handle exceptional situations, ambiguous contractual language, or unforeseen events. Human oversight therefore remains necessary to ensure fairness and prevent unjust outcomes.

Advantages of Smart Contracts and AI in Legal Systems

One of the most important advantages of smart contracts and AI is efficiency. Legal procedures are often time-consuming and expensive. Automated systems can process information and execute transactions much faster than traditional methods. This may significantly reduce delays in legal administration and dispute resolution. Cost reduction is another major benefit. Legal services frequently involve substantial expenses due to administrative procedures and professional fees. Automation may reduce operational costs and make legal services more affordable for businesses and individuals. Consistency in decision-making is also improved through AI systems. Human interpretation may vary between individuals, leading to inconsistent outcomes in similar cases. AI systems can apply predefined rules consistently, increasing predictability and reducing uncertainty in certain legal processes. Transparency is enhanced through blockchain technology. Since blockchain records are generally permanent and traceable, parties can verify transactions independently. This reduces opportunities for fraud, corruption, or unauthorized modifications. The automation of legal processes may also improve access to justice. Individuals who cannot afford traditional legal services may benefit from AI-powered legal assistance platforms. Technology can therefore contribute to greater legal awareness and accessibility.

Legal and Ethical Risks

Despite their benefits, AI and smart contracts present serious legal and ethical concerns. Bias remains one of the most significant risks associated with AI systems. Since AI operates using historical data, discriminatory patterns present within the data may influence automated outcomes. This can result in unfair treatment of certain individuals or groups. Transparency is another major issue. Legal systems require reasoned decisions that can be reviewed and challenged. Certain AI models operate through complex algorithms that are difficult to explain. This lack of explainability may undermine public trust and procedural fairness. Privacy concerns are equally important. AI systems depend heavily on data collection and analysis. Improper handling of personal information may violate privacy rights and data protection laws. Cybersecurity threats also create risks of unauthorized access and financial harm. Accountability becomes complicated when automated systems produce errors. Determining liability may involve developers, software providers, organizations, or users. Legal systems must therefore establish clear rules regarding responsibility and compensation. Another concern relates to excessive technological dependence. Law is not merely a technical process but a human institution guided by moral and constitutional principles. Automated systems may fail to account for emotional suffering, social realities, or exceptional circumstances that require compassion and discretion.

Future of AI and Smart Contracts in Legal Systems

The future of legal systems is likely to involve greater integration of AI and blockchain technology. Governments, courts, corporations, and international organizations are increasingly investing in legal technology to improve efficiency and accessibility. Smart contracts may become standard tools in commercial transactions, international trade, banking, insurance, and digital asset management. AI systems may continue to support legal research, dispute prediction, compliance monitoring, and judicial administration. Legal education will also evolve as future lawyers are required to understand technology, cybersecurity, data protection, and digital governance. The legal profession may increasingly combine traditional legal expertise with technological knowledge. However, the future development of these technologies must remain guided by legal and ethical safeguards. Regulatory frameworks must ensure fairness, transparency, accountability, and protection of human rights. Human oversight should remain central to legal systems to ensure that technology supports justice rather than replacing it entirely.

Conclusion

The rise of smart contracts and Artificial Intelligence marks a transformative stage in the evolution of legal systems. These technologies have the potential to modernize legal processes, reduce costs, improve efficiency, and expand access to justice. Smart contracts provide automated enforcement of agreements, while AI enhances legal research, analysis, and administrative efficiency. At the same time, their growing use creates complex legal, ethical, and constitutional challenges. Concerns relating to bias, accountability, transparency, cybersecurity, and the preservation of human judgment continue to shape debates regarding the future of legal technology. Law is fundamentally connected to justice, morality, and human dignity. While technology can strengthen legal systems and improve their functioning, it cannot fully replace the human reasoning and ethical judgment that remain essential to the administration of justice. The future of AI and smart contracts in legal systems will therefore depend on achieving a careful balance between technological innovation and the protection of fundamental legal principles. The ultimate objective should not be the complete automation of law but the responsible use of technology to create legal systems that are more efficient, transparent, accessible, and fair for society as a whole.
